Police arrest Migori woman, 24, after lover, 52, dies in lodging

Police in Migori have arrested a 24-year-old woman after her lover, 52, died in a lodging at Nyatike on Friday morning.

The Directorate of Criminal Investigations (DCI) said the man's lifeless body was found at Lavanda lodging in West Kanyarwanda Sub-Location.

It remains unclear what caused his death.

"The man's body was found on the bed," the DCI said on Twitter on Friday, July 29.

Police said preliminary investigations reveal that the man collapsed and died hours after booking himself into the lodging facility.

"He'd been accompanied by his 24-year-old girlfriend," said the DCI.

The man's body was moved to the Migori County Referral Hospital morgue, awaiting postmortem.

His girlfriend was arrested and taken to a Nyatike police post for interrogation.
